# 26 U.S.C. § 7504 - Fractional parts of a dollar
## Text
The Secretary may by regulations provide that in the allowance of any amount as a credit or refund, or in the collection of any amount as a deficiency or underpayment, of any tax imposed by this title, a fractional part of a dollar shall be disregarded, unless it amounts to 50 cents or more, in which case it shall be increased to 1 dollar.
(Aug. 16, 1954, ch. 736, 68A Stat. 896; Pub. L. 94455, title XIX, § 1906(b)(13)(A), Oct. 4, 1976, 90 Stat. 1834.)
## Notes
Editorial Notes
Amendments1976—Pub. L. 94455 struck out “or his delegate” after “Secretary”.
